Summary

Shirayuki is an herbalist famous for her naturally bright-red hair, and the prince of Tanbarun wants her all to himself! The prince from the neighboring kingdom, Zen, rescues her from her plight, and thus begins their love story。

Kiki’s potential suitors are being attacked one after the other, and Mitsuhide has been arrested as the prime suspect! Will Hisame’s scheme to position himself as Kiki’s likeliest groom allow Zen and the gang to root out the real mastermind behind the attacks?!

Mark

The most dangerous job in the kingdom turns out to be seeking Kiki’s hand in marriage, as her suitors are under attack by unknown assailants。 Suspicion is directed onto Mitsuhide, which is ridiculous, but clearly serves a more sinister purpose that Zen and his crew now need to figure it out。It’s refreshing to say that this is a pretty strong entry for a series that has been up its own butt for several volumes now; it really jumps back to life with this instalment, finally deciding to add a littl The most dangerous job in the kingdom turns out to be seeking Kiki’s hand in marriage, as her suitors are under attack by unknown assailants。 Suspicion is directed onto Mitsuhide, which is ridiculous, but clearly serves a more sinister purpose that Zen and his crew now need to figure it out。It’s refreshing to say that this is a pretty strong entry for a series that has been up its own butt for several volumes now; it really jumps back to life with this instalment, finally deciding to add a little show back to the tell。Instead of fake plant research, we get palace intrigue and secret plots and things that are actually far more relatable (and interesting)。 The whole volume focuses on this and, to its credit, this is the first time that the Zen and Shirayuki pairing hasn’t been sorely missed (Shirayuki is barely in this volume and it works just fine)。Things start with an excellent swerve where Hisame, who had previously failed to win Kiki’s hand, volunteers to complicate matters to tip the odds in the heroes’ favour, but clearly recognizes that he’s not got a chance of succeeding a second time around。 It’s a quiet but welcome acknowledgment of the past。Mitsuhide is going to Mitsuhide, so he does what he’s told and plays his cards close to his chest, which is his character, somewhat to his own detriment。 Meanwhile, Zen proves that he’s got the brains to do a good job as ruler with his sharp eyes and clever plotting。There are ambushes and feats of derring-do and last minute surprises and complicated familial bonds all wrapped up in a story, as yet unresolved, that offers a little moral about the difference in ruling by fear versus ruling by nobility。 Which is a far cry from plant life and would be absolutely perfect except for the usual problems this book has and one I don’t know that I noticed before。First off, at this stage we basically need a line of succession or something detailing all the houses。 The reader should not need to take notes to follow the houses here and keeping track of who belongs where is a nightmare。And it might be me, but I’m starting to get the sense that the lack of action stems from this mangaka not being great at it。 There are panels which don’t clearly lead to one another, which you could chalk up to the chaos of battle, but are far too hard to follow at times。Also, everybody looking vaguely similar is thrown into even worse relief with a family of twins and a brother who also have Zen’s “white” hair on the page and look like him。 I literally had to track one fight by the colour of a character’s pants。 There’s a reason for this at times, but it shouldn’t be that much of a chore。That this remains such a good volume is a testament to its writing, which goes for something a bit meatierat long last and finally feels like the story isn’t actually pulling its punches (brother dearest is something else)。3。5 stars - and, yes, let’s round it up because it’s the most rewarding this story has been in a long time and made me genuinely feel like it had been worth sticking with。 。。。more
